The sermon was delivered on Sunday, September 4, 2016, at All Souls Unitarian Church in Tulsa, Oklahoma, by Steven Williams, Student Minister.

SERMON DESCRIPTION

There’s a passage in Matthew 5 that starts, “When the Son of Man comes... All the nations will be gathered before him, and he will separate people one from another as a shepherd separates the sheep from the goats.” Instead of taking a literal approach to this statement, I think it represents what kind of behavior God wants from people, and what the world would look like in the best case scenario, where we act in our common interest — or the worst case scenario, where we act in our self-interest. When we act like goats, which are hierarchical, everyone-for-oneself creatures, then the world suffers. But, when we act in the interest of all humanity, we allow for eternal life.
